What are some common challenges faced by a Manager Solaire (Solar Manager) when overseeing renewable energy projects?

A Manager Solaire often faces challenges such as coordinating multidisciplinary teams, navigating complex regulatory environments, and ensuring project timelines stay on track despite weather or supply chain delays. Balancing budget constraints while maintaining high safety and quality standards is also a key concern. Effective communication with stakeholders—including engineers, clients, and local authorities—is crucial to address issues swiftly and keep projects moving forward.

What is a Manager Solaire?

A Manager Solaire is a professional responsible for overseeing solar energy projects, including their development, installation, and maintenance. They coordinate teams, manage budgets, ensure compliance with regulations, and work to optimize the performance of solar installations. Their role often includes project management, technical oversight, and liaising with stakeholders such as clients, suppliers, and regulatory bodies. Managers Solaire play a crucial role in advancing renewable energy solutions and ensuring the success of solar initiatives.
